Reality vs - www.jimplacknews.com. Opinion A fact is info that can be verified as real or false (2 + 2 = 4). A point of view is an expression of a person's feelings which might or may not be based upon reality ("that structure is going to collapse"). As well as "spin" or "publicity" is when particular pieces of information are assembled in such a way to make you think something is real.


Be cautious that studies can be deceptive and quickly manipulated. It's definitely necessary to recognize WHO conducted the study and their inspiration. That PAID for the research. How much time, over what period of time, was the study conducted. THE NUMBER OF individuals were involved in the study? HOW was the details collected? What is the CONTEXT of the information? And lots of other such inquiries.


Do not count on simply one research study method or kind of person for your details. Using all the mixed methods and talking with people from all sides of the problem will certainly give you with a much richer, precise and also well rounded photo of your subject. Fact-checking functions to minimize fallacies around the world, according to a new study carried out in four countries. Researchers located that fact-checking collaborated with little variation in Argentina, Nigeria, South Africa and the U.K., and also the positive effects were still detectable two weeks later. A lot more motivating, there was no proof of a "backfire" impact of fact-checking, said Thomas Timber, co-author of the study and also aide professor of political scientific research at The Ohio State College."When we started doing misinformation job concerning five years ago, it was the agreement that correcting false information had not been just inefficient, yet that it was aggravating the issue and making individuals more established in their incorrect beliefs," Timber said."We found no evidence of that in these 4 countries.




The research was released Sept. 6, 2021 in the Process of the National Academy of Sciences. The scientists collaborated with fact-checking organizations in the four nations that become part of the International Fact-Checking Network, a company that advertises detached and transparent fact-checking. They reviewed five fact-checks that were unique to each country as well as 2 concerning COVID-19 and also climate adjustment that were examined in all four countries.


Several of the 2,000 individuals in each nation received just the misinformation, while others got the misinformation adhered to by the real improvements used by regional fact-checking organizations in reaction to false information - click here to read. They then rated just how much they thought the incorrect statement on a scale of 1-5. In each nation, members of a control team did not get any kind of misinformation or corrective statements, yet merely ranked exactly how much they thought the statements.

Two subjects were examined in all 4 countries. One involved climate modification, screening how much individuals thought the false statement, generally shared at the time, that there were 2 years of record-breaking international air conditioning in between 2016 and also 2018 - https://jimplacknews.com. An additional examined the false declaration, which was extensively shared near the beginning the COVID-19 pandemic, that swishing deep sea would avoid infection with the coronavirus.


But the misinformation concerning COVID-19 did reduced precision in 3 of the four nations as well as had the biggest misinformation results discovered in the research study. Nonetheless, the fact-checks did assist enhance precision on this issue.
